Поделиться через


EFI_DISPLAY_POWER_PROTOCOL

Этот протокол позволяет приложению UEFI для зарядки батареи выключать экран после указанного простоя во время зарядки в среде UEFI.

Синтаксис

#define EFI_DISPLAY_POWER_PROTOCOL_GUID \
  {0xf352021d, 0x9593, 0x4432, {0xbf, 0x4, 0x67, 0xb9, 0xf3, 0xb7, 0x60, 0x8};

typedef struct _EFI_DISPLAY_POWER_PROTOCOL {  
    UINT32                                    Revision;  
    EFI_DISPLAY_POWER_SETDISPLAYPOWERSTATE    SetDisplayPowerState;  
    EFI_DISPLAY_POWER_GETDISPLAYPOWERSTATE    GetDisplayPowerState;  
} EFI_DISPLAY_POWER_PROTOCOL;

Члены

Редакция
Редакция, которой соответствует EFI_DISPLAY_POWER_PROTOCOL . Все будущие редакции должны быть обратно совместимы. Если будущая версия не совместима с обратной совместимостью, необходимо использовать другой GUID.

Текущая редакция 0x00010000. Если эта редакция EFI_BATTERY_CHARGING_PROTOCOL поддерживается встроенного ПО, необходимо задать значение 0x00010000.

SetDisplayPowerState
Изменяет состояние питания дисплея и подсветки. Дополнительные сведения см. в разделе EFI_DISPLAY_POWER_PROTOCOL. SetDisplayPowerState.

GetDisplayPowerState
Возвращает текущее состояние питания дисплея и подсветки. Дополнительные сведения см. в разделе EFI_DISPLAY_POWER_PROTOCOL. GetDisplayPowerState.

Требования

Заголовка: Создано пользователем